Transaction 896fedc3988ec8ecf19c5017dae5671a6e96f0ff8a76ad13f6c1761a471aeb57
1 Input
1 Output
-
896fedc3988ec8ecf19c5017dae5671a6e96f0ff8a76ad13f6c1761a471aeb57:0
- value
- 66425897
- script pubkey
- OP_0 OP_PUSHBYTES_20 0f7f744483d51bb005d6da0afe0aa9ca066a17b6
- address
- bc1qpalhg3yr65dmqpwkmg90uz4fegrx59ak0fvrk7